Allow me to explain this one last time.

WE DO NOT GET MONEY FROM ORDERS FROM THE GENTOO STORE.

In fact, currently Gentoo has no way to accept money of any kind.  The
only thing we can take is hardware contributions.  We own very little of
our infrastructure.  Going out and buying hardware to replace hardware
that we have for free isn't exactly a good way to spend money.  Going
out and buying bandwidth to replace bandwidth that we are receiving for
free from the same people giving us hardware isn't exactly a good way to
spend money.
